Abstract

Aviation safety is a condition for fulfilling safety requirements in the use of airspace, aircraft, airports, air navigation and supporting facilities, and other public facilities. To achieve flight safety, the person in charge of carrying out flight operations service activities, monitoring aircraft movements, vehicle traffic, people and goods, air cleanliness, and recording and flight are called Apron Movement Control (AMC). This study aims to determine the level of mental workload based on the classification of respondents, indicators and also based on the characteristics of research subjects such as age, years of service and positions held by AMC personnel at Yogyakarta Adisutjipto International Airport where the airport is one of the busiest international airports that the complexity of air traffic, both from within the country and from abroad. The process carried out was to measure the overall mental workload of the six subscales, namely mental demand, physical demand, temporal demand, performance, frustration, and effort using the NASA-TLX (Task Load Index) method where the steps needed to be carried out were weighting, rating, calculating product values, calculating weighted workload, calculating WWL averages, and interpreting scores to determine the level of mental workload experienced by AMC personnel. Based on result of the research conducted, the level of mental workload on the pesonil apron movement control (AMC) in Yogyakarta Adisutjipto airport is based on the three characteristics of the subjects there are Age, Working Period and Position. The three subject characteristics at AMC in Adisutjipto have high types. Based on result of the research in the Apron Movement Control (AMC) unit Angkasa Pura 1 Yogyakarta Adisucipto International Airport, the interpretation of the recapitulation of the calculation of the mental workload value of employees in the class of mental workload is very high, amounting to 6 people and a high of 5 people.
